Just signed the papers today on a 2019 M4CS

San Marino Blue
$107K MSRP
Selling price: $78K (Including Lease and Loyalty Incentives)
24 month lease/10K miles per year
$763/month tax included with $1K out of pocket

.00165 Money Factor
63% Residual

Quote:
Originally Posted by spool twice View Post
incredible deal! yes, the BMWCCA is something I'm looking into as well. Can you purchase this right at the dealer at time of sale as well for instant discount for payment?
The dealership has nothing to do with BMWCCA. You sign up for it on your own. Also, the BMWCCA rebate is a rebate. In other words, it comes weeks after the purchase. For some time you were unable to take advantage of the BMWCCA rebate unless you were a member at least 12 months prior. That has since changed but I would check eligibility to ensure the requirements have not changed.

****updated with corrected #'s****

Signing for my M4CS now (msrp $105,745), $764 w/ tax ($715 w/o), .00165 MF, 3yrs, and 10,000 miles/yr

Taxes/dealer fees/tags & reg ($1,7××), 4 MSD's due at signing. Total discounts with $5250 lease rebate, $2500 loyalty, and $1000 OL = $27,467 ...dealer waived my 1st month payment, however it may have been a marketing tool (claimed to be a mistake on the contract).

Add another $29-30/month if I hadn't elected the MSD's. The MSD's basically was equivalent to approx a $1,000 downpayment, but then again that "1st month payment waived" was probably baked into my monthly payment too (+$21/mo)...oh well, price was spot on to my liking so.
